Hi.. Do I need to get the Eligibility certificate from Mumbai university to apply in ILS Law college for BA LLB? Can you send me the link? I checked in Mumbai university official website, not able to find out the link to apply.

Yes, you will have to produce the Eligibility Certificate if you are have completed your education from outside Maharashtra and are applying for admission at ILS Law College, Pune. It is one of the important documents that you have to produce in the admission process of ILS Pune. The college will cancel your candidature and not give you admission if you fail to produce an Eligibility Certificate.

To apply for an Eligibility Certificate, you will have to fill and submit the form through the official website of the Mumbai University. You can also purchase the form from the administrative office and submit it along with the fee of Rs. 400. Your documents will be verified and the certificate will be sent to you within 7-10 working days.
